Tires are a very critical component for any vehicle, not only to support the weight but also to ensure performance, safety and fuel efficiency with comfort and durability. One of the important ingredients in the rubber compounds that make up tires is carbon Black. Benefits of using carbon black tyres 

  1. Reinforcement with durability: One of the primary benefits of using carbon black tireis to reinforce the rubber compounds because rubber alone is not at all strong enough for long-term use under the stress which tyres face, that is, friction, load, heat and pressure. Carbon black will always be helpful in improving the strength of the rubber by increasing the resistance to abrasion, cuts and wear and tear. According to the experts, this will help in promoting the durability with reinforcement for extended product life. This makes sure that the tyre will wear out more slowly and will further maintain the depth and performance over long distances. For the customers, this will translate to fewer tire replacements with low cost of maintenance and better overall value.

  5. Better in terms of air retention and low permeability: Maintaining the proper tyre pressure is very much critical for safety, fuel economy and even the other associated aspects. Carbon Black tyres for inner liners are engineered with the motive of reducing the air permeability, which will ensure that tyre loss will be slow in comparison to other options in terms of pressure. Fewer pressures will be dropping, making sure that there will be fewer adjustments and less penalty on fuel, which eventually will result in better performance of the tire.
